You can do:
temperature_control.bed.beta 3950 # or set the beta value
(Less accurate, but fine for a heated bed)
Or
temperature_control.bed.coefficients 0.0006454337947,0.0002239473005,0.000000087 #Alirubber 800W 120V
The last one was calculated by @Zane_Baird via the Steinhart Hart coefficients method: steinharthart [smoothieware.org]
